/frameworks/support/v17/leanback/src/android/support/v17/leanback/widget/ |
ClassPresenterSelector.java | 19 * A ClassPresenterSelector selects a {@link Presenter} based on the item's 24 private final HashMap<Class<?>, Presenter> mClassMap = new HashMap<Class<?>, Presenter>(); 26 public void addClassPresenter(Class<?> cls, Presenter presenter) { 27 mClassMap.put(cls, presenter); 31 public Presenter getPresenter(Object item) { 33 Presenter presenter = null; local 36 presenter = mClassMap.get(cls) [all...] |
SinglePresenterSelector.java | 17 * A {@link PresenterSelector} that always returns the same {@link Presenter}. 22 private final Presenter mPresenter; 25 * @param presenter The Presenter to return for every item. 27 public SinglePresenterSelector(Presenter presenter) { 28 mPresenter = presenter; 32 public Presenter getPresenter(Object item) {
|
ItemBridgeAdapter.java | 24 * Bridge from Presenter to RecyclerView.Adapter. Public to allow use by third 35 public void onAddPresenter(Presenter presenter, int type) { 50 * Interface for wrapping a view created by presenter into another view. 63 private ArrayList<Presenter> mPresenters = new ArrayList<Presenter>(); 85 final Presenter mPresenter; 86 final Presenter.ViewHolder mHolder; 92 * Get {@link Presenter}. 94 public final Presenter getPresenter() 218 Presenter presenter = presenterSelector.getPresenter(item); local 239 Presenter presenter = mPresenters.get(viewType); local [all...] |
PresenterSwitcher.java | 28 private Presenter mCurrentPresenter; 29 private Presenter.ViewHolder mCurrentViewHolder; 33 * {@link PresenterSelector} for choose {@link Presenter} for object. 62 Presenter presenter = mPresenterSelector.getPresenter(object); local 63 if (presenter != mCurrentPresenter) { 66 mCurrentPresenter = presenter;
|
ControlBarPresenter.java | 25 * A presenter that assumes a LinearLayout container for a series 28 * Different layouts may be passed to the presenter constructor. 31 class ControlBarPresenter extends Presenter { 36 * The data type expected by this presenter. 45 * The presenter to be used for the adapter objects. 47 Presenter presenter; field in class:ControlBarPresenter.BoundData 54 void onControlSelected(Presenter.ViewHolder controlViewHolder, Object item, 62 void onControlClicked(Presenter.ViewHolder controlViewHolder, Object item, 66 class ViewHolder extends Presenter.ViewHolder [all...] |
SparseArrayObjectAdapter.java | 21 * Construct an adapter with the given {@link Presenter}. 23 public SparseArrayObjectAdapter(Presenter presenter) { 24 super(presenter);
|
ArrayObjectAdapter.java | 34 * Construct an adapter that uses the given {@link Presenter} for all items. 36 public ArrayObjectAdapter(Presenter presenter) { 37 super(presenter);
|
CursorObjectAdapter.java | 37 * Construct an adapter that uses the given {@link Presenter} for all items. 39 public CursorObjectAdapter(Presenter presenter) { 40 super(presenter);
|
ObjectAdapter.java | 112 * Construct an adapter that uses the given {@link Presenter} for all items. 114 public ObjectAdapter(Presenter presenter) { 115 setPresenterSelector(new SinglePresenterSelector(presenter)); 125 * Set the presenter selector. May not be null. 129 throw new IllegalArgumentException("Presenter selector must not be null"); 152 * Returns the presenter selector for this ObjectAdapter. 225 * Returns the {@link Presenter} for the given item from the adapter. 227 public final Presenter getPresenter(Object item) { 229 throw new IllegalStateException("Presenter selector must not be null") [all...] |
ListRowPresenter.java | 95 private HashMap<Presenter, Integer> mRecycledPoolSize = new HashMap<Presenter, Integer>(); 123 * Sets the row height for rows created by this Presenter. Rows 134 * Returns the row height for list rows created by this Presenter. 141 * Sets the expanded row height for rows created by this Presenter. 153 * Returns the expanded row height for rows created by this Presenter. 246 public void onAddPresenter(Presenter presenter, int type) { 248 type, getRecycledPoolSize(presenter)); 258 * Sets the recycled pool size for the given presenter [all...] |
FocusHighlightHelper.java | 219 Presenter presenter = mViewHolder.getPresenter(); local 220 if (presenter instanceof RowHeaderPresenter) { 221 ((RowHeaderPresenter) presenter).setSelectLevel( method
|
PlaybackControlsRowPresenter.java | 45 public final Presenter.ViewHolder mDescriptionViewHolder; 58 Presenter.ViewHolder mSecondaryControlsVh; 61 Presenter.ViewHolder mSelectedViewHolder; 75 ViewHolder(View rootView, Presenter descriptionPresenter) { 115 Presenter getPresenter(boolean primary) { 153 private Presenter mDescriptionPresenter; 162 public void onControlSelected(Presenter.ViewHolder itemViewHolder, Object item, 176 public void onControlClicked(Presenter.ViewHolder itemViewHolder, Object item, 195 * @param descriptionPresenter Presenter for displaying item details. 197 public PlaybackControlsRowPresenter(Presenter descriptionPresenter) [all...] |
/external/chromium_org/third_party/WebKit/Source/web/ |
NotificationPresenterImpl.cpp | 46 void NotificationPresenterImpl::initialize(WebNotificationPresenter* presenter) 48 m_presenter = presenter;
|
NotificationPresenterImpl.h | 44 void initialize(WebNotificationPresenter* presenter);
|
/frameworks/base/core/java/com/android/internal/view/menu/ |
MenuBuilder.java | 208 * Add a presenter to this menu. This will only hold a WeakReference; 209 * you do not need to explicitly remove a presenter, but you can using 212 * @param presenter The presenter to add 214 public void addMenuPresenter(MenuPresenter presenter) { 215 addMenuPresenter(presenter, mContext); 219 * Add a presenter to this menu that uses an alternate context for 221 * need to explicitly remove a presenter, but you can using 224 * @param presenter The presenter to ad 253 final MenuPresenter presenter = ref.get(); local 275 final MenuPresenter presenter = ref.get(); local 291 final MenuPresenter presenter = ref.get(); local 314 final MenuPresenter presenter = ref.get(); local 947 final MenuPresenter presenter = ref.get(); local 1078 final MenuPresenter presenter = ref.get(); local 1263 final MenuPresenter presenter = ref.get(); local 1285 final MenuPresenter presenter = ref.get(); local [all...] |
/frameworks/support/v7/appcompat/src/android/support/v7/internal/view/menu/ |
MenuBuilder.java | 231 * Add a presenter to this menu. This will only hold a WeakReference; you do not need to 232 * explicitly remove a presenter, but you can using {@link #removeMenuPresenter(MenuPresenter)}. 234 * @param presenter The presenter to add 236 public void addMenuPresenter(MenuPresenter presenter) { 237 addMenuPresenter(presenter, mContext); 241 * Add a presenter to this menu that uses an alternate context for 243 * need to explicitly remove a presenter, but you can using 246 * @param presenter The presenter to ad 275 final MenuPresenter presenter = ref.get(); local 297 final MenuPresenter presenter = ref.get(); local 313 final MenuPresenter presenter = ref.get(); local 336 final MenuPresenter presenter = ref.get(); local 992 final MenuPresenter presenter = ref.get(); local 1125 final MenuPresenter presenter = ref.get(); local 1311 final MenuPresenter presenter = ref.get(); local 1333 final MenuPresenter presenter = ref.get(); local [all...] |
/development/samples/SupportLeanbackDemos/src/com/example/android/leanback/ |
VerticalGridFragment.java | 19 import android.support.v17.leanback.widget.Presenter; 39 public Adapter(StringPresenter presenter) { 40 super(presenter); 72 public void onItemSelected(Presenter.ViewHolder itemViewHolder, Object item, 80 public void onItemClicked(Presenter.ViewHolder itemViewHolder, Object item,
|
/frameworks/base/tools/layoutlib/bridge/src/com/android/layoutlib/bridge/bars/ |
FrameworkActionBar.java | 175 ActionMenuPresenter presenter = mActionBar.getActionMenuPresenter(); local 176 if (presenter == null) { 177 throw new RuntimeException("Failed to create a Presenter for Action Bar Menus."); 179 if (presenter.isOverflowReserved() &&
|
/packages/apps/InCallUI/src/com/android/incallui/ |
CallCardPresenter.java | 51 * Presenter for the Call Card Fragment. 55 public class CallCardPresenter extends Presenter<CallCardPresenter.CallCardUi> 80 CallCardPresenter presenter = mCallCardPresenter.get(); local 81 if (presenter != null) { 82 presenter.onContactInfoComplete(callId, entry, mIsPrimary); 88 CallCardPresenter presenter = mCallCardPresenter.get(); local 89 if (presenter != null) { 90 presenter.onImageLoadComplete(callId, entry);
|
/packages/apps/Mms/src/com/android/mms/ui/ |
SlideshowEditActivity.java | 392 Presenter presenter = PresenterFactory.getPresenter( local 394 ((SlideshowPresenter) presenter).setLocation(position); 395 presenter.present(null);
|
/frameworks/support/v17/leanback/src/android/support/v17/leanback/app/ |
RowsFragment.java | 33 import android.support.v17.leanback.widget.Presenter; 54 final Presenter.ViewHolder mRowViewHolder; 140 private ArrayList<Presenter> mPresenterMapper; 152 * item presenter sets during {@link Presenter#onCreateViewHolder(ViewGroup)}. 175 * item presenter sets during {@link Presenter#onCreateViewHolder(ViewGroup)}. 378 public void onAddPresenter(Presenter presenter, int type) { 379 ((RowPresenter) presenter).setOnItemClickedListener(mOnItemClickedListener) [all...] |
RowsSupportFragment.java | 35 import android.support.v17.leanback.widget.Presenter; 56 final Presenter.ViewHolder mRowViewHolder; 142 private ArrayList<Presenter> mPresenterMapper; 154 * item presenter sets during {@link Presenter#onCreateViewHolder(ViewGroup)}. 177 * item presenter sets during {@link Presenter#onCreateViewHolder(ViewGroup)}. 380 public void onAddPresenter(Presenter presenter, int type) { 381 ((RowPresenter) presenter).setOnItemClickedListener(mOnItemClickedListener) [all...] |
/frameworks/base/tools/aidl/ |
generate_java_rpc.cpp | 380 append(iface->name.data, ".Presenter"), 909 // _presenter = new Presenter(_broker, listener); 964 EventListenerClass* presenter = new EventListenerClass(iface, listener->type); local [all...] |
/frameworks/base/core/java/android/widget/ |
ActionMenuView.java | 108 * @param presenter Menu presenter used to display popup menu 111 public void setPresenter(ActionMenuPresenter presenter) { 112 mPresenter = presenter;
|
/frameworks/support/v7/appcompat/src/android/support/v7/widget/ |
ActionMenuView.java | 115 * @param presenter Menu presenter used to display popup menu 118 public void setPresenter(ActionMenuPresenter presenter) { 119 mPresenter = presenter;
|